// STALE_TTL_SECONDS exists because of the Brindlewood outage.
// Postmortem summary: the edge cache for Perchsite served stale
// pricing for six hours after origin recovery, because eviction
// keyed off last-write rather than last-validation. Raising this
// TTL past 300 reintroduces that failure mode — the revalidation
// sweep runs every 240s and needs headroom. If you change this
// value, update the sweep interval in tandem and rerun the
// staleness soak test. The build that fixed it is recorded below.

trace token, fafog-kageg: htk4_98e6

Facilities Ticket — Door Sensor Recall

Status: Open. Location: Thornley Annex, Levels 2–4.

The manufacturer, Quillbeck Controls, has recalled the batch of magnetic door sensors fitted on Levels 2 through 4. Visiting contractors from Ashdene Systems will replace all affected units this week. Automatic entry on those floors is disabled until the swap is complete, so doors must be opened manually. To unlock the stairwell doors during the works, enter the code below.

door code, yagap-bahof: bdg-O-05

**Vendor note: Inkmill markdown pipeline**

Rendering for Parchway docs is outsourced to Inkmill under an annual contract, renewing each March. They handle sanitization and PDF export; we own the upload queue. SLA: 4-hour response on rendering failures. Escalate only after two failed retries. Their support desk is reachable at the address below.

billing contact of hahaf-baguf = zorael.tammir.jorius@sivrelhq.internal

14:22 — Offline sync regression confirmed (Terrapath field-survey app)

At 14:22 the on-call engineer reproduced the data-loss path: surveys saved while offline were marked synced once connectivity returned, even when the upload was rejected. The queue flush skipped the server acknowledgement check introduced in the previous sprint. Release manager note: the fix must ship before the coastal survey season. The offending build is identified by the token recorded below.

session token of kawif-fawig = htk31_f3f599be2b1a34affb1efa8d0feccf8